本方案旨在构建一个高效、安全的在线购物平台。通过采用先进的加密技术、智能搜索算法和用户行为分析,提升购物体验。强化数据安全防护,确保用户隐私和交易安全。方案涵盖平台架构、功能模块、系统优化等方面,助力企业打造优质购物环境。
随着互联网的快速发展,电子商务已成为我国经济发展的重要引擎,购物网站作为电子商务的核心载体,其技术实施方案的优劣直接影响到用户体验和平台的竞争力,本文将从购物网站的技术架构、功能模块、安全防护等方面,详细阐述购物网站的技术实施方案。

技术架构
1、分布式架构
购物网站采用分布式架构,可以实现高并发、高可用、可扩展的特点,具体包括:
(1)前端展示层:负责用户界面展示,采用HTML5、CSS3、J*aScript等技术实现。
(2)业务逻辑层:负责处理用户请求,实现商品管理、订单处理、支付等功能,采用J*a、Python、PHP等编程语言实现。
(3)数据访问层:负责数据存储和查询,采用MySQL、Oracle、MongoDB等数据库实现。
(4)服务层:负责提供公共服务,如用户认证、权限管理、缓存等,采用Redis、Memcached等技术实现。
2、微服务架构
购物网站采用微服务架构,将业务功能拆分为多个独立的服务,提高系统的可维护性和可扩展性,具体包括:
(1)商品服务:负责商品信息的存储、查询、修改等操作。
(2)订单服务:负责订单的创建、修改、查询、取消等操作。
(3)支付服务:负责处理支付请求,与第三方支付平台对接。
(4)用户服务:负责用户信息的注册、登录、修改、查询等操作。
功能模块
1、商品管理模块
(1)商品分类:实现商品分类的创建、修改、删除等操作。
(2)商品信息:实现商品信息的添加、修改、删除、查询等操作。
(3)商品库存:实现商品库存的实时监控和预警。
2、订单管理模块
(1)订单创建:实现订单的创建、修改、删除等操作。
(2)订单查询:实现订单的查询、筛选、导出等操作。
(3)订单跟踪:实现订单物流信息的实时跟踪。
3、支付模块
(1)支付接口:实现与第三方支付平台的对接,支持多种支付方式。
(2)支付通知:实现支付成功的通知,包括短信、邮件、站内信等。
(3)退款处理:实现订单退款的申请、审核、处理等操作。
4、用户管理模块
(1)用户注册:实现用户注册、激活、修改等操作。
(2)用户登录:实现用户登录、退出、找回密码等操作。
(3)用户权限:实现用户权限的分配、修改、查询等操作。
安全防护
1、数据安全
(1)数据加密:对敏感数据进行加密存储和传输。
(2)访问控制:实现用户权限的严格控制,防止数据泄露。
(3)数据备份:定期进行数据备份,确保数据安全。
2、系统安全
(1)防火墙:部署防火墙,防止恶意攻击。
(2)入侵检测:部署入侵检测系统,实时监控系统安全。
(3)漏洞修复:定期对系统进行漏洞修复,提高系统安全性。
购物网站技术实施方案是构建高效、安全的在线购物平台的关键,通过采用分布式架构、微服务架构,以及完善的功能模块和安全防护措施,可以提升购物网站的用户体验和竞争力,在今后的工作中,我们将继续优化技术实施方案,为用户提供更加优质的服务。